Audemars Piguet Unveils Three New Perpetual Calendars
Audemars Piguet expands its latest-generation perpetual calendar collection with the introduction of three new references that emphasize both mechanical transparency and advanced materials. The new releases include the first open-worked interpretations of the brand’s next-generation perpetual calendar, alongside the first Royal Oak Perpetual Calendar crafted entirely in ceramic and powered by the automatic Calibre 7138.
Open-Worked Perpetual Calendars in the Code 11.59 and Royal Oak Collections
Two of the newly introduced models feature open-worked dials that reveal the structure and operation of Audemars Piguet’s Calibre 7139. Originally unveiled in 2025, this movement represents a revised approach to the perpetual calendar complication, designed to improve ergonomics while preserving the traditional mechanical logic of the complication.

Both watches share the same case architecture as their closed-dial counterparts but replace the solid dial with a skeletonized construction. This open-worked layout exposes the calendar mechanism, bridges, and gear trains, allowing the wearer to observe the perpetual calendar components as they function and are adjusted via the crown.
The Code 11.59 Perpetual Calendar Openworked is housed in a white gold case combined with a black ceramic mid-case, a defining feature of the Code 11.59 line. The movement is presented in a predominantly rhodium-toned finish, with contrasting hands and calendar indications designed to maintain legibility despite the complexity of the open display.

The Royal Oak Perpetual Calendar Openworked is executed in titanium and incorporates polished accents made from Palladium-based bulk metallic glass on the bezel studs and bracelet links. Rose gold hands and calendar markers provide visual contrast against the monochromatic movement architecture, reinforcing the technical character of the Royal Oak while ensuring clear readability.
First All-Ceramic Royal Oak Perpetual Calendar
The third release marks the first time Audemars Piguet has paired its latest-generation perpetual calendar movement with a fully ceramic Royal Oak case and bracelet. This model is powered by Calibre 7138 and features a solid dial rather than an open-worked display, offering a more traditional presentation of the complication.

The ceramic components are produced in a deep blue tone developed specifically to match Audemars Piguet’s historic “Bleu Nuit, Nuage 50” color, originally associated with the Royal Oak’s earliest dials. This darker, more nuanced shade represents a refinement of the brand’s previous blue ceramic executions and aligns closely with the collection’s heritage.
Calibre 7138 and 7139: A New Generation of Perpetual Calendar Movements
At the heart of all three watches are Audemars Piguet’s Calibres 7138 and 7139, which share the same technical foundation, with Calibre 7139 adapted for open-worked configurations. The movements retain the classical “grand lever” perpetual calendar architecture while introducing a modernized user interface.

All calendar indications, including the day, date, month, leap year, and moon phase, can be adjusted exclusively via the crown. This design eliminates the need for traditional case-side correctors and allows for more intuitive operation. A key component of the movement is a 48-tooth program wheel that mechanically encodes the varying lengths of the months across the four-year leap-year cycle. As a result, the calendar will remain accurate until the year 2100, when the Gregorian calendar omits a leap year, at which point the movement can be corrected without requiring disassembly or factory intervention.
Finishing and Manufacturing
The finishing of the new perpetual calendar movements is particularly emphasized in the open-worked versions. Audemars Piguet states that the bridges are initially formed using advanced machining techniques before undergoing extensive hand-finishing. The calibres feature a high number of interior angles, polished bevels, and carefully brushed surfaces, highlighting the complexity of both the design and manufacturing process.

Despite the use of modern production methods, each movement reportedly requires several dozen hours of manual finishing. This combination of contemporary engineering and traditional handcraft reflects Audemars Piguet’s approach to high-end perpetual calendar watchmaking.

General Specifications:
Brand: Audemars Piguet
Model: Code 11.59 Selfwinding Perpetual Calendar Openworked, Royal Oak Selfwinding Perpetual Calendar Openworked, Royal Oak Perpetual Calendar Selfwinding
Reference: 26443NB.OO.D002CR.01, 26685XT.OO.1320XT.01, 26674CD.OO.1225CD.01
Dial: Openworked (Code 11.59, Royal Oak openworked), “Bleu Nuit, Nuage 50” (Royal Oak)
Lume: Yes
Case Material: White gold and black ceramic (Code 11.59), titanium and palladium (Royal Oak openworked), ceramic and titanium (Royal Oak)
Case Dimensions: 41 mm x 10.60 mm (Code 11.59), 41 mm x 9.50 mm (Royal Oak’s)
Crystal: Sapphire Glass
Case Back: Sapphire Glass
Water Resistance: 30 Meters (Code 11.59), 50 meters (Royal Oak’s)
Strap: Alligator leather strap with a white gold clasp (Code 11.59), integrated titanium and palladium / ceramic and titanium bracelet (Royal Oak’s)
Calibre: 7139 (Code 11.59, Royal Oak openworked), 7138 (Royal Oak)
Functions: Hour, minutes, weekly calendar, perpetual calendar, moon phase
Winding: Automatic
Frequency: 4 Hz (28,800 Vph)
Power Reserve: 55 Hours
Price: CHF 118,000 (Code 11.59), CHF 180,200 (Royal Oak openworked), CHF 133,900 (Royal Oak)
Limited Edition: No
Availability: Now
